Can Photovoltaic Panels Block Feng Shui? Exploring the Solar Energy-Feng Shui Paradox

When Ancient Wisdom Meets Modern Tech: The Great Energy Debate

Let's face it - nothing kills dinner party conversation faster than arguing about photovoltaic panels and feng shui. Yet here we are, in 2024, watching homeowners across Asia (and beyond) wrestle with this modern dilemma. Can you really harness solar power without blocking your home's qi flow? Or are we literally putting our energy future in conflict with ancient wisdom?

The 3 Core Feng Shui Concerns About Solar Panels

Traditional feng shui masters often raise these objections:

  • Metal-heavy structures disrupting wood element balance
  • Panel angles creating "poison arrows" of sharp energy
  • Roof coverage blocking celestial qi absorption

But before you cancel your solar installation, consider this: Singapore's Urban Redevelopment Authority reported a 40% increase in feng shui-compliant solar projects since 2022. Apparently, it's possible to teach an old philosophy new tricks.
